Алгоритм безопасного хэширования SHA и расхождения в криптовалютах, изучающие взаимосвязь

Криптовалюта

В постоянно развивающемся мире криптовалют безопасный алгоритм хэширования, известный как SHA, играет решающую роль в обеспечении целостности и безопасности различных систем на основе блокчейна. Разработанный Агентством национальной безопасности (АНБ) в начале 1990-х годов, SHA стал фундаментальным компонентом в создании таких криптовалют, как Биткойн и Эфириум. Целью этой статьи является исследование взаимосвязи между алгоритмом SHA и различиями в сфере криптовалют.

Алгоритм SHA, в частности SHA-256, предназначен для создания уникального 256-битного хеш-значения для любого заданного ввода. Эта криптографическая хеш-функция является детерминированной, что означает, что она всегда будет генерировать одно и то же хэш-значение для одного и того же ввода. Это свойство позволяет проверять целостность данных и играет решающую роль в механизме консенсуса криптовалют на основе блокчейна.

Применяя алгоритм SHA-256 к блоку транзакций, майнеры могут создавать уникальное значение хеш-функции, представляющее данные внутри этого блока. Это хеш-значение затем используется в качестве основы для доказательства работы и является важным компонентом механизма консенсуса в криптовалютах.

Более того, взаимосвязь между SHA и различиями в криптовалютах становится очевидной при рассмотрении распространения различных сетей блокчейнов.С появлением альткоинов и появлением многочисленных блокчейн-платформ, каждая из которых имеет свой собственный набор протоколов и криптографических функций, использование SHA в качестве алгоритма хеширования расширилось.

Введение:

Название «Алгоритм безопасного хеширования SHA и дивергенция в криптовалюте, изучающая взаимосвязь» — это исследовательская работа, в которой исследуется взаимосвязь между алгоритмом безопасного хеширования SHA и дивергенцией в криптовалюте. Цель этой статьи — дать представление о том, как алгоритм SHA влияет на безопасность и стабильность цифровых валют.

Алгоритм SHA, разработанный Агентством национальной безопасности (АНБ), широко используется в различных криптографических приложениях, включая криптовалюты. Это криптографическая хэш-функция, которая принимает входные данные (например, сообщение или данные) и выдает выходные данные фиксированного размера, называемые хэш-значениями. Это значение хеш-функции уникально для входных данных, а это означает, что даже небольшое изменение входных данных приведет к значительному изменению значения хеш-функции.

Это свойство алгоритма SHA имеет решающее значение для безопасности криптовалют. Используя SHA для генерации хеш-значений для каждой транзакции и блока в блокчейне, цифровые валюты могут создать защищенную от несанкционированного доступа и прозрачную систему. Каждое изменение, внесенное в блокчейн, приведет к изменению значений хеш-функции, предупреждая пользователей о любой попытке изменить или манипулировать данными.

В этой статье мы рассмотрим взаимосвязь между алгоритмом SHA и дивергенцией криптовалют. Под дивергенцией понимается появление разных версий блокчейна, обычно вызванное форками или другими изменениями в правилах консенсуса. Мы рассмотрим, как алгоритм SHA влияет на возникновение и разрешение расхождений, а также его последствия для безопасности и стабильности цифровых валют.

Промокоды на Займер на скидки

Займы для физических лиц под низкий процент

  • 💲Сумма: от 2 000 до 30 000 рублей
  • 🕑Срок: от 7 до 30 дней
  • 👍Первый заём для новых клиентов — 0%, повторный — скидка 500 руб

Краткое объяснение важности безопасных алгоритмов хеширования в криптовалюте.

В мире криптовалют безопасные алгоритмы хеширования играют решающую роль в обеспечении целостности и безопасности цифровых транзакций. Алгоритм безопасного хэширования, такой как SHA (алгоритм безопасного хеширования), представляет собой криптографическую функцию, которая принимает входные данные (или сообщение) и создает выходные данные фиксированного размера (хеш-значение), уникальные для этих входных данных.

Одной из ключевых причин использования безопасных алгоритмов хэширования в криптовалютах является предотвращение подделки данных транзакций. При совершении транзакции важно гарантировать, что данные, связанные с этой транзакцией, остаются неизменными. Благодаря применению безопасного алгоритма хэширования к данным транзакции любое незначительное изменение данных приведет к совершенно другому значению хеш-функции. Это позволяет легко обнаружить любые изменения или попытки взлома.

Кроме того, безопасные алгоритмы хеширования обеспечивают уровень защиты от потенциальных атак, таких как атаки на прообразы и атаки на основе коллизий. Атака прообраза — это попытка найти входные данные, которые создают определенное хеш-значение, а атака коллизией — это попытка найти два разных входных данных, которые создают одно и то же значение хеш-функции. Алгоритмы безопасного хеширования разработаны таким образом, чтобы быть устойчивыми к этим атакам, что делает манипулирование данными злоумышленникам чрезвычайно трудным и дорогостоящим в вычислительном отношении.

Еще одним важным аспектом безопасных алгоритмов хеширования в криптовалюте является их роль в обеспечении неизменности блокчейна. Блокчейн, лежащий в основе криптовалют, представляет собой распределенный реестр, содержащий записи всех транзакций. Каждый блок в блокчейне содержит хеш-значение, которое рассчитывается на основе хеш-значения предыдущего блока. При этом создается цепочка блоков, в которой любое изменение в одном блоке приведет к изменению хеш-значений всех последующих блоков. Таким образом, безопасные алгоритмы хеширования имеют решающее значение для поддержания целостности и неизменности блокчейна.

Таким образом, безопасные алгоритмы хеширования имеют первостепенное значение в криптовалюте, поскольку они защищают целостность данных транзакций, обеспечивают защиту от различных атак и обеспечивают неизменность блокчейна. Без безопасных алгоритмов хеширования основа криптовалют будет уязвима для манипуляций и взлома, что подрывает доверие и надежность всей системы.

Обзор понятия дивергенции в криптовалютах

В мире криптовалют под дивергенцией понимается ситуация, когда возникают две или более версии криптовалюты, что приводит к разделению или разветвлению блокчейна. Это может произойти по разным причинам, например, из-за различий в идеологии, обновлений протоколов или разногласий среди сообщества.

Когда происходит расхождение, оно создает две отдельные цепочки с разными правилами и особенностями. Это может привести к созданию новых криптовалют или продолжению существования исходной криптовалюты с измененными правилами. Самым известным примером расхождения в криптовалютах является форк Биткойна, который привел к созданию Bitcoin Cash.

Дивергенцию в криптовалютах можно разделить на два основных типа: хард-форки и софт-форки. Хард-форк происходит, когда в блокчейне происходит постоянное разделение, в результате чего образуются две отдельные и независимые криптовалюты. Напротив, софт-форк — это временное расхождение, когда новая версия криптовалюты обратно совместима со старой версией.

Хард-форки обычно происходят, когда внутри сообщества возникают фундаментальные разногласия, и группа разработчиков решает создать новую криптовалюту с измененными правилами. Это может привести к расколу в сообществе: некоторые участники примут новую версию, а другие будут придерживаться исходной версии.

Софт-форки, с другой стороны, обычно происходят, когда возникает необходимость обновления или улучшения протокола криптовалюты.В рамках софт-форка новая версия криптовалюты обратно совместима, а это означает, что узлы, использующие старую версию, по-прежнему могут без проблем участвовать в сети. Это помогает сохранить единое сообщество и снизить вероятность постоянного раскола.

В целом, концепция дивергенции криптовалют играет значительную роль в эволюции и развитии криптоэкосистемы. Это позволяет внедрять инновации и экспериментировать, но в то же время создает проблемы с точки зрения поддержания консенсуса и сплоченности сообщества.

I. Алгоритм безопасного хеширования SHA:

SHA (Secure Hash Algorithm) — это широко используемая криптографическая хэш-функция, которая используется в различных приложениях, включая криптовалюту. Он предназначен для приема входных данных и выдачи выходных данных фиксированного размера, обычно 256-битного (32-байтового) хеш-значения. Алгоритм SHA используется для обеспечения целостности и безопасности данных в криптовалютных транзакциях.

SHA была разработана Агентством национальной безопасности (АНБ) в конце 20 века и с тех пор стала стандартной хеш-функцией в криптографическом сообществе. Он широко используется в протоколах криптовалют, таких как Биткойн и Эфириум.

Криптографическая хэш-функция — это математический алгоритм, который принимает входные данные (сообщение) и выдает выходные данные фиксированного размера (хеш-значение), уникальные для входных данных. Это означает, что даже небольшое изменение входных данных приведет к значительному изменению значения хеш-функции. Кроме того, алгоритм SHA также обладает свойством быть односторонним, что означает, что вычислительно невозможно преобразовать входные данные из выходных.

Алгоритм SHA работает в несколько этапов, включая предварительную обработку сообщения, заполнение сообщения, сжатие сообщения и генерацию вывода. Он использует ряд логических операций, включая побитовые операции и модульное сложение, для обеспечения безопасности и целостности хеш-значения.

Одним из основных преимуществ использования SHA в криптовалюте является его устойчивость к коллизиям.Коллизия возникает, когда два разных входа дают одно и то же значение хеш-функции. Алгоритм SHA предназначен для минимизации вероятности коллизий, что делает его очень безопасным для использования в криптовалютах.

В целом, алгоритм SHA играет решающую роль в безопасности и целостности криптовалют, обеспечивая надежный и безопасный способ защиты данных и транзакций. Его широкое использование в индустрии криптовалют подчеркивает его важность и эффективность в обеспечении неизменности и надежности блокчейна.

Справедливые и развернутые ответы на вопросы о криптовалюте

Что такое алгоритм безопасного хеширования SHA?
Алгоритм безопасного хеширования SHA — это криптографическая хэш-функция, которая обычно используется в различных приложениях безопасности, включая криптовалюты. Он принимает входные данные (например, сообщение или данные) и выдает выходные данные фиксированного размера, называемые хешем, которые уникальны для входных данных.
Почему алгоритм безопасного хеширования SHA важен для криптовалют?
Алгоритм безопасного хеширования SHA играет решающую роль в криптовалютах, поскольку он обеспечивает целостность и безопасность блокчейна. Каждый блок в блокчейне криптовалюты содержит хеш предыдущего блока, который создает цепочку блоков. Алгоритм SHA используется для расчета этих хэшей, что делает практически невозможным внесение каких-либо вредоносных изменений в блокчейн без обнаружения.
Можете ли вы объяснить взаимосвязь между алгоритмом безопасного хеширования SHA и дивергенцией в криптовалюте?
Да, взаимосвязь алгоритма SHA Secure Hash Algorithm и дивергенции в криптовалюте основана на том, что даже небольшое изменение входных данных приведет к совершенно другому результату хеширования. Это свойство криптографических хеш-функций гарантирует, что любые расхождения или изменения в хешируемых данных приведут к значительному изменению хеш-значения, что позволяет обнаруживать любые попытки вмешательства в блокчейн криптовалюты.

❓За участие в опросе консультация бесплатно